Frontend-разработчик/Angular

Оплата не указана

Вакансия находится в архиве

Формула Би Ай

Шелепиха

и еще 1 станция

г. Москва

Требуемый опыт работы

От 3 до 6 лет

Тип занятости

Полная занятость

График работы

Полный день

В связи с расширением портфеля проектов активно ищем специалистов в группу IT-компаний. Мы - сплоченная команда системных аналитиков и разработчиков на технологической платформе Sherp. Наши специалисты имеют многолетний и уникальный опыт проектирования, разработки и внедрения корпоративных информационных систем в государственных и коммерческих организациях.

Приглашаем Вас присоединиться к нашему сообществу, если поставленные задачи и предлагаемые условия Вам подходят.

Чем мы занимаемся:

Разработка собственных технологических продуктов:

  • Платформа для разработки приложений (b2b решение),
  • Разработка личных кабинетов (b2c решения),
  • Реализация приложений в разных форматах (web, pwa, native).

Технологии, которые мы используем

NET/C#, Angular, ionic, SCSS, HTML5, Nginx, Docker

Чем ты будешь заниматься:

  • Разработка интерфейсных компонентов;

  • Реализация взаимодействия с Web API;

  • Визуализация данных, дизайн и верстка;

  • Разработка анимационных эффектов.

Что ты должен уметь:

Адаптивная кросс-браузерная верстка:

- Иметь опыт верстки адаптивных сайтов, лендингов, а также порталов и админ панелей компонентным подходом;

- Иметь понимание использования БЭМ методологии (именно понимание, а не что такое блок элемент и модификатор);

- Уверенно владеть css свойствами, понимать работу препроцессоров (scss), а также custom properties (css переменных);

- Уметь грамотно использовать html тэги и понимать концепцию семантики, а также понимать DOM модели браузера;

- Понимать панели DevTools.

JavaScript и Angular:

- Типы данных, контекст вызова, стрелочные функции, классы, методы объектов/массивов, мутабельность/иммутабельность, rest spread операторы, event loop, понятие асинхронного кода;

- Понимание что такое TypeScript и особенности написания кода на нем;

- Хуки жизненного цикла;

- Понимание компонентов, модулей, сервисов, директив, пайпов и т.д.;

- Умение обдумано и грамотно писать код (типизированный, с аннотациями, придерживаться как минимум принципа SRP);

- Понимание принципов системы авторизации/регистрации, что такое токены (jwt к примеру), а также маршрутизация страниц;

- Иметь понимание (а в идеале опыт работы) что такое RxJS и что такое Observable и его дочерние классы.

А также:

- Опыт работы с системами контроля версий (Git), npm;

- Опыт работы с файлами, временем (unix datetime, iso time), с переводами, различными цветовыми схемами на сайте;

- Опыт работы в команде (желательно);

- Умение гуглить и находить ответы на вопросы (если ответов так и не нашел, можно спросить у коллег).

Условия:

  • Формат работы: комбинированный или дистанционный. Обязательным условием является пребывание на связи в течение рабочего дня;
  • Зарплата определяется по итогам собеседования, исходя из Ваших компетенций и опыта. Вы даете результат – мы достойную, конкурентную оплату;
  • Официальное трудоустройство по ТК РФ;

  • Работа в аккредитованной Минцифры IT компании;
  • Мы обеспечим Вас интересными задачами и проектами. Попадая в нашу команду, Вы попадаете в коллектив профессионалов, настроенных на долгосрочное сотрудничество;
  • Мы ценим своих коллег, их стремление к профессиональному росту и даем возможность развиваться за счет компании.

Ключевые навыки

Css3
Html5
Scss
Angular
Typescript
Javascript

Адрес

Москва, 1-й Магистральный тупик, 11с1

Контактная информация

Формула Би Ай

Сайт: formulabi.ru

Почта: не указана

Вакансия опубликована 23.07.2024 в г. Москва.

Похожие вакансии

#

Москва

Полный день

Подробное описание

19 марта

#

Москва

Полный день

Подробное описание

23 августа